Abstract
The invention discloses medicine for treating erysipelas and a preparation method thereof. The medicine is mainly prepared by lonicera japonica, rhizoma coptidis, rhizoma belamcandae, incised notopterygium, radix bupleuri, rhizoma cimicifugae, mentha haplocalyx, platycodon grandiflorum, radix isatidis, fructus aurantii immaturus, radix pueraiae, caulis akebiae, flos chrysanthemi indici, phaseolus calcaratus, cyrtomium fortunei, radix ophiopogonis, gypsum, paris polyphylla, herba violae, radix rubiae, olibanum, bombyx batryticatus, cortex phellodendri and lophatherum gracile according to a certain weight proportion. The medicine for treating the erysipelas is capable of clearing away heat and toxic materials, cooling blood and relieving swelling, tonifying the spleen and stomach and treating high fever and high heat-toxin, quick in action, good in curative effect and free of relapse.

Detailed description of the invention
The drug dose of instant component is also that inventor draws through groping in a large number to sum up, and the consumption of each component all has good curative effect within the scope of following weight:
Flos Lonicerae 15-25 gram, Rhizoma Coptidis 10-20 gram, Rhizoma Belamcandae 5-15 gram, Rhizoma Et Radix Notopterygii 5-15 gram, Radix Bupleuri 5-15 gram, Rhizoma Cimicifugae 15-25 gram, Herba Menthae 4-8 gram, Radix Platycodonis 5-15 gram, Radix Isatidis 5-15 gram, Rhizoma Smilacis Glabrae 5-15 gram, Fructus Aurantii Immaturus 5-10 gram, Radix Puerariae 15-25 gram, Caulis Akebiae 4-8 gram, Flos Chrysanthemi Indici 15-25 gram, Semen Phaseoli 15-25 gram, Rhizoma Osmundae 7-12 gram, Radix Ophiopogonis 7-12 gram, Gypsum Fibrosum 15-25 gram, Rhizoma Paridis 5-15 gram, Herba Violae 15-25 gram, Radix Rubiae 10-20 gram, Olibanum 10-15 gram, Bombyx Batryticatus 4-8 gram, Cortex Phellodendri 5-15 gram, Fructus Arctii 10-20 gram, Herba Lophatheri 5-10 gram, Radix Glycyrrhizae 3-7 gram, Rhizoma Chuanxiong 5-10 gram, Rhizoma Phragmitis 15-25 gram, Radix Angelicae Pubescentis 10-20 gram, Folium eucalypti globueli (Eucalyptus globulus Labill.) 20-30 gram.
Be preferably:
Flos Lonicerae 20 grams, Rhizoma Coptidis 15 grams, Rhizoma Belamcandae 10 grams, Rhizoma Et Radix Notopterygii 10 grams, Radix Bupleuri 10 grams, Rhizoma Cimicifugae 20 grams, Herba Menthae 6 grams, Radix Platycodonis 10 grams, Radix Isatidis 10 grams, Rhizoma Smilacis Glabrae 10 grams, Fructus Aurantii Immaturus 8 grams, Radix Puerariae 20 grams, Caulis Akebiae 6 grams, Flos Chrysanthemi Indici 20 grams, Semen Phaseoli 20 grams, Rhizoma Osmundae 9 grams, Radix Ophiopogonis 9 grams, 20 grams, Gypsum Fibrosum, Rhizoma Paridis 10 grams, Herba Violae 20 grams, 15 grams, Radix Rubiae, Olibanum 12 grams, Bombyx Batryticatus 6 grams, Cortex Phellodendri 10 grams, Fructus Arctii 15 grams, Herba Lophatheri 8 grams, 5 grams, Radix Glycyrrhizae, Rhizoma Chuanxiong 8 grams, Rhizoma Phragmitis 20 grams, Radix Angelicae Pubescentis 15 grams, Folium eucalypti globueli (Eucalyptus globulus Labill.) 25 grams.

Two, prepare
1, the Flos Lonicerae after the process of preparing Chinese medicine, Rhizoma Coptidis, Rhizoma Belamcandae, Rhizoma Et Radix Notopterygii, Radix Bupleuri, Rhizoma Cimicifugae, Herba Menthae, Radix Platycodonis, Radix Isatidis, Rhizoma Smilacis Glabrae, Fructus Aurantii Immaturus, Radix Puerariae, Caulis Akebiae, Flos Chrysanthemi Indici, Semen Phaseoli, Rhizoma Osmundae, Radix Ophiopogonis, Gypsum Fibrosum, Rhizoma Paridis, Herba Violae, Radix Rubiae, Olibanum, Bombyx Batryticatus, Cortex Phellodendri, Fructus Arctii, Herba Lophatheri, Radix Glycyrrhizae, Rhizoma Chuanxiong, Rhizoma Phragmitis, Radix Angelicae Pubescentis, Folium eucalypti globueli (Eucalyptus globulus Labill.) are put into decocting container, add water 8 times amount for the first time, soak after 100 minutes, intense fire decocts boiling, use slow fire boiling again 20 minutes, filter first time decoction liquor, first time decoction liquor is poured in container.
2, add water the medicinal residues of filtration 5 times amount, and intense fire boils, then uses slow fire boiling 20 minutes, filters to obtain second time decoction liquor.
3, namely twice decoction liquor mixing and stirring is obtained admixing medical solutions, be divided into 4 doses to take.

The animal toxicity test report of [test example 1] medicine of the present invention:
Get rabbit 30, male and female dual-purpose, body weight 2.0-2.5kg, divide two groups, often organize 15, wherein one group is overdose test group, and another group is normal amount test group.Taking admixing medical solutions super quantity group is 20ml/kg, and normal amount is 10ml/kg, and administering mode is administration by gavage administration, twice daily, serve on 7 days, observes administration reaction every day, and result shows that two groups of rabbit are movable, diet is normal, and medicine is without bad toxic and side effects.
The clinical observation on the therapeutic effect of [test example 2] medicine of the present invention
1, physical data
Accept erysipelas out-patient totally 33 examples for medical treatment.
2, diagnostic criteria
Classical symptom is nauseating for generating heat suddenly, shivering with cold, do not accommodate.There is erythema in a few hours, and Progressive symmetric erythrokeratodermia expands after 1 day, boundary clear.Affected part Pi Wengao, anxiety, and occur scleroma and nonpitting edema, affected area has tenderness, causalgia, commonly closely defends lymphadenectasis, companion or do not accompany lymphadenitis.Also the symptoms such as the hemorrhagic necrosis of pustule, vesicle or small size can be there is.
3, Therapeutic Method
Select above-mentioned medicament, take to patient, each serving with 1 dose, every day early, evening respectively takes 1 time, within 8 days, is a course for the treatment of, takes 3 courses for the treatment of continuously.
4, efficacy assessment standard
Effective: erysipelas transference cure, body constitution recovers normal, recovery from illness;
Take a turn for the better: patient generates heat, shiver with cold, sense of discomfort is eliminated, and closely defend lymphadenectasis, symptom alleviates, and erysipelas symptom is clearly better;
Invalid: not reach improvement standard person.
5, therapeutic outcome (seeing the following form)
In above-mentioned treatment, by Drug therapy erysipelas patient 33 example of the present invention, effective 25 examples of result, obvious effective rate is 75.26%, and take a turn for the better 6 examples, and improvement rate is 18.18%, and invalid 2 examples, total effective rate is 93.94%.
